Выбор параметров LC-фильтра для ШИМ сигнала

Abstract

Предложена методика инженерного расчета параметров LC-фильтра для высокочастотного ШИМ сигнала. Получены формулы локальной аппроксимации для основных инженерных характеристик фильтра: коэффициент гармоник, коэффициент эффективности, коэффициент жесткости характеристики. Локальная аппроксимация позволяет выбрать оптимальное соотношение между характеристиками фильтра. The procedure of engineering design of LC-filter parameters for high-frequency PWM signal has been proposed. The formulas of local approximation for basic filter engineering characteristics such as harmonic content, efficiency factor, characteristic stiffness factor are obtained.
